A few days ago something very exciting arrived in the post - a half wig from Annabelle's Wigs. I'm aware that this may seem strange, seeing as I have plenty of hair naturally, however one of my new years resolutions is to go cold turkey with heat styling, and I still wanted to be able to achieve that big, voluminous blow dried look. After reading about Annabelle's half wigs on Stephanie Dreams, I figured it was worth a try.
Admittedly I was somewhat sceptical. My hair is a tricky one to colour match, however their cherry red colour is a close enough shade. My second concern was texture. Other artificial wigs I've worn have been distinctly plasticy, however the texture of this one is far more realistic, and it falls and brushes like real hair. What's great about these half wigs is that you have your own hair at the front, so if you style tactfully (or wear a big headband!) there are no tell-tale wig seams.
My only complaint would be the weight of the hair piece combined with my already fairly thick hair, but it's entirely worth it for the final effect. The half wigs wave and shine is like my own hair on a really polished day. It was such a treat to have big, glamorous hair that only took five minutes to style and didn't require any heat.
